你查询的IP:[159.226.96.116]  地理位置:中国–北京–北京科技网

最新查询122.112.73.138 117.124.187.123 119.62.195.138 123.112.183.210 114.80.138.193 117.106.153.169 59.155.7.43 124.42.183.7 122.136.35.43 159.226.96.116 59.107.185.186 117.72.193.126 125.213.89.201 203.132.32.53 116.52.64.105 203.184.80.178 202.120.210.165 202.136.224.246 203.94.251.195 125.171.237.240 116.196.249.167 124.160.30.50 60.247.17.97 117.48.72.138 203.191.16.209 202.165.176.87 116.212.160.170 123.8.189.65 124.196.253.209 203.209.224.184 202.90.224.43